CARD RECIPE
 (Ingredients found in Supply List)
  • Create your background. I used Atelier Re-Inkers to watercolor my background on Watercolor paper. I also added a layer of Liquid Pixie Dust for added sparkle before adding the splatters. Set aside to dry.
  • Die-cut pieces from the Shoot for the Moon scene. Some will be on the inside and some die-cuts will be glued to the outside. I used cardstock from the SILVER SERVICE paper pad US|UK.
  • Figure out where you want to stamp out the greeting. 
  • Prepare the surface for heat embossing and stamp sentiment. My paper was very textured at this stage and the impression I got wasn't the best. In hindsight, I should have stamped the sentiment before adding all the splatters.
  • To the Moon, I attached a clear thread. See the picture below. This will allow for the moon to wiggle a little when the card is being shaken.
  • Wrap the thread around the back of the panel and secure the line with a piece of tape. 
  • Trim the background to A2 size. You may need to trim it slightly smaller to fit nicely into the Shaker pocket | UK .

  • Place the panel finished side face down onto the shaker pocket. Fold and secure 3 of the tabs to the backside of the panel.
  • Fill the shaker pocket with the shaker bits.
  • Seal the pocket by gluing down the last tab.
  • Attach the shaker panel to the card base using strong double-sided tape.
  • Finish the scene by gluing on the remaining die-cuts along the bottom of the panel. This also hides the fact that there are shaker bits inside adding that surprise element.

CARD DETAILS

I kept all 3 cards fairly simple, which was easy to do with the size of these fonts and designs. 

For this first friendship card, I began by stamping the tribal herringbone pattern stamp from the Backgrounds & Borders Stamp Set US|UK vertically down the left side of a piece of black cardstock cut to A2 size. I used white pigment ink and then heat embossed it with white EP.

To add some color I used chalk markers and metallic gel pens to color in some of the spaces of the pattern.

I then lined up the dies from the Backgrounds & Borders Stamp Die Set and die cut all three words from the panel. At this point, I glued the panel to the card base. This then made it easy to see the negative spaces and line up all the letters. For each word, I then stacked 3 die-cut layers together and glued each letter back into the corresponding place. I used the gold cardstock from the Gold Hearted Paper Pad US|UK.

This next card turned out to be my favorite and it was super simple to make. To add the embossing detail to the center of the hexagons I lined up and taped the circle embossing plates to the linked hexagon die openings and then ran it through the die-cut machine. I repeated this using 3 types of cardstocks, three times. Gold cardstock comes from the Gold Hearted Pad US|UK and the silver glitter comes from the Silver Service Pad US|UK.

I then started by gluing the gold hexagon strip along the bottom edge, followed by the glitter one and then the black one. Even though these all nest together, I liked the look of the white peeking through the background. The space in between was all eyeballed. As you can see I then finished off the top by slicing the top edge off of the hexagon strip. With the piece that was cut off, I then used it to finish off the bottom and cut off any excess.

For this sentiment, I used the Hey You stamp from the stamp set that was stamped and heat set in white on black cardstock and then used the circle die to cut it out. I then just popped it up with foam tape and added it to one of the black hexagons.

This last card was also fun to make, I love how these stamps and dies work together so effortlessly. 

For this card, I die cut the top and the bottom using the same arrow die-cut design. I then cut the center area using the irregular dot design die.

Moving along, I stamped the in-between spaces using multiple stamps to create stamped borders. Here again, I used metallic gel pens to add some color to the card. 

I then glued silver glitter and gold cardstock strips in behind the openings and then glued the panel to the card base.

Next, I die cut, stacked, and glued together the letters using the MISS die and glued them onto the center-right of the card panel. To finish off the greeting I stamped the YOUR FACE from the stamp set onto a black strip of paper that I trimmed and then popped up just below it.

  • 6x8" stamp and die set contains 18 stamps and 18 dies
  • STAMPS: The four larger stamp strips can be easily used to create a background by stamping once, moving the paper over exactly 1", and stamping again. Repeat to fill your background.
  • The thinner stamp strips (stripes and ladder) can be stamped, move the cardstock 1/4", stamp and repeat... or, combine stamps to make unique backgrounds.
  • DIES: Combine the word dies with the stamp sentiments to make bold sentiments for your backgrounds. Use the strip dies to create patterned die cut background and shaker cards.
